An Improved Cluster Head Algorithm for Wireless Sensor Networkroved algorithm avoids direct communication between BS and the cluster head which has low energy and is far away from BS, which prolongs the lifetime of network and enhances the ability of data collection. The experiments show that this technique of event-driven can cut down the data transmission and further extend the lifetime of network.作者: Jogging 時(shí)間: 2025-3-28 14:09
The Universal Approximation Capability of Double Flexible Approximate Identity Neural Networksapproximate identity functions and flexible approximate identity functions as investigated in our previous studies. Then, we prove that any continuous function . with two variables will converge to itself if it convolves with double flexible approximate identity. Finally, we prove a main theorem by using the obtained results.作者: CLAIM 時(shí)間: 2025-3-28 16:17

Computation Method of Processing Time Based on BP Neural Network and Genetic Algorithme training efficiency of BPNN, GA is used to optimize its connection weights and thresholds. The encoding method, selection operation, crossover, and mutation operation of GA are discussed in detail. The higher computation precision and faster operation speed of the proposed method is demonstrated through application cases.作者: 主動(dòng)脈 時(shí)間: 2025-3-30 00:34 作者: Neonatal 時(shí)間: 2025-3-30 05:04 作者: airborne 時(shí)間: 2025-3-30 12:06
A New Model for Short-Term Power System Load Forecasting Using Wavelet Transform Fuzzy RBF Neural Neences, and then, the suitable RBF neural networks for the forecasting are selected. Finally, the load forecasting sequence is obtained by the reconstruction of the forecasted results from the subsequences. The simulation results demonstrate the proposed method possesses validity and practicability with a mean absolute error below 1.5 %.作者: 挖掘 時(shí)間: 2025-3-30 13:47 作者: 不可磨滅 時(shí)間: 2025-3-30 17:32 作者: 嚴(yán)厲譴責(zé) 時(shí)間: 2025-3-30 22:38 作者: 個(gè)人長(zhǎng)篇演說 時(shí)間: 2025-3-31 01:32 作者: 男生如果明白 時(shí)間: 2025-3-31 06:43
